LSU Baseball coach Paul Mainieri will be inducted into the American Baseball Coaches Association Hall of Fame on Friday Night.

Per LSUSports.net:
quote:

In receiving the highest honor that can be bestowed upon a college baseball coach, Mainieri becomes just the 10th Southeastern Conference coach to enter the ABCA Hall of Fame, and the second from LSU. Skip Bertman, who led the Tigers to five national titles during his 18-season tenure (1984-2001), was inducted in 2003.

Mainieri has a 1,179-625-7 record in 31 seasons of collegiate coaching and led LSU to the 2009 College World Series Championship. Congrats coach Mainieri.
